Isolation and Distribution of Streptococcus Suis Capsular Types from Diseased Pigs in Spain
12 Jan 1993
Abstract excerpt
A total of 65 isolates of Streptococcus suis was recovered from various tissues of diseased pigs. Almost 96% of all these isolates could be categorized as one of capsular types 1 to 22 and 1/2. Capsular type 2 was the most prevalent and represented 53.8% of all isolates, followed by capsular types 1 (9.2%), 1/2 (7.7%) and 8 (4.6%).
